Wheat flour is a main ingredient used in a wide range of food products, including bread, cakes, cookies, pies, noodles, Ramen, and Udon. It also plays an important role in processed food products such as sauces, and battered or fried foods, enhancing their texture and structure. Wheat flour has unique properties, such as elasticity, extensibility, structure-building ability, and leavening support, which are essential for creating the desired texture and form in many types of food products.
